Sri Lanka's ICT Sector Sees Unprecedented Service Export Growth

Sri Lanka's ICT Sector Sees Unprecedented Service Export Growth

Sri Lanka's information and communication technology (ICT) sector is experiencing a remarkable transformation, with service exports reaching new heights. This surge is not just a statistic; it reflects the country's strategic positioning in the global digital landscape. As the world becomes increasingly reliant on technology, Sri Lanka is carving out a niche for itself among emerging markets. Current trends highlight why this development is critical for both the local and global economies.

The Current Landscape of ICT Service Exports

The ICT industry in Sri Lanka has long been regarded as a cornerstone of economic advancement. Recent reports show a staggering growth rate in service exports, which have now surpassed historical records. In a time when many countries struggle with economic challenges, Sri Lanka's ICT sector stands out as a beacon of resilience and innovation.

Key Drivers of Growth

  • Increased Global Demand: Businesses worldwide are seeking reliable technology services, contributing to a surge in outsourcing agreements.
  • Government Initiatives: The Sri Lankan government has actively promoted the ICT sector through various incentives and support programs.
  • Skilled Workforce: A young, tech-savvy population is driving innovation and attracting foreign investment.

Understanding the Impact on the Economy

This growth isn't merely about figures on a balance sheet; it has far-reaching implications for Sri Lanka’s economy and its workforce. As the ICT sector expands, it creates job opportunities and stimulates ancillary industries. In particular, it fosters an environment where startups can thrive, thereby diversifying the economy.

Job Creation and Skills Development

With the ICT sector's rapid evolution, there is a growing demand for skilled professionals. Educational institutions are responding by enhancing their curricula to equip students with the necessary skills. This initiative ensures that graduates are well-prepared to enter a contributing role in the industry.
